eq(f0(A,B,C,D,E,F,G),1,[f10(1,1,H,0,2,1,G,I,J,K,L,M,N,O,P),loop_cont_f10(J,K,L,M,N,O,P)],[I=0,H>=0]). eq(f0(A,B,C,D,E,F,G),1,[f10(1,1,H,0,2,1,G,I,J,K,L,M,N,O,P)],[I=1,H>=0]). eq(f10(A,B,C,D,E,F,G,H,I,J,K,L,M,N,O),1,[f21(A,B-1,C,D,E,F,0,H,I,J,K,L,M,N,O)],[F>=1,E>=F,B>=1,0>=C]). eq(f10(A,B,C,D,E,F,G,H,I,J,K,L,M,N,O),1,[f21(A+1,A+1,P,D,E,F,Q,H,I,J,K,L,M,N,O)],[Q>=0,1>=Q,P>=0,F>=1,E>=F,0>=B,0>=C]). eq(f10(A,B,C,D,E,F,G,H,I,J,K,L,M,N,O),1,[f21(A,B,C-1,D,E,F,P,H,I,J,K,L,M,N,O)],[P>=0,1>=P,F>=1,C>=1,E>=F]). eq(f21(A,B,C,D,E,F,G,H,I,J,K,L,M,N,O),1,[f10(A,B,C,D,E,F-1,G,H,I,J,K,L,M,N,O)],[E+1>=A,0>=G]). eq(f21(A,B,C,D,E,F,G,H,I,J,K,L,M,N,O),1,[f10(A,B,C,D,E,F+1,G,H,I,J,K,L,M,N,O)],[E+1>=A,G>=1]). eq(f10(A,B,C,D,E,F,G,H,A,B,C,D,E,F,G),1,[],[H=1,0>=F,E>=F]). eq(f10(A,B,C,D,E,F,G,H,A,B,C,D,E,F,G),1,[],[H=1,F>=1+E]).